Europe’s dealers focus on used cars, aftersales to survive slump
Europe’s leading independent dealer groups have turned their focus to selling more used cars and making more money from aftersales to survive the region’s new-car sales slump.

Chrysler brand chief Chehab leaves to head Maserati marketing
Saad Chehab, head of the Chrysler and Lancia brands, is Maserati’s new chief marketing officer. New Chrysler brand head is Al Gardner, head of Chrysler’s southeast business center in Florida.

Hyundai randd president, 2 other execs resign over quality problems
Hyundai says its research and development president, Kwon Moon-sik, and two other executives have resigned over a string of quality problems.

In the battle for lease business, captives are kings
The captive finance companies have a lock on leasing. Eight of the top 10 leasing companies are captives, data from Experian Automotive show. The other two are Ally Financial Inc. and Chase Auto Finance, which offer leases for automaker partners.
